Transaction 84531744b3afccb34fbe346e468ed946102c370a48d16e7134deedf8e78781a2

1 Input
2 Outputs
  • 84531744b3afccb34fbe346e468ed946102c370a48d16e7134deedf8e78781a2:0
  • value  435475
    address  3NrwwubKpQdyUSa4V1rWrThnJipaG6BKgW
  • 84531744b3afccb34fbe346e468ed946102c370a48d16e7134deedf8e78781a2:1
  • value  1599434822
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V